Plaja Criuleni
Plaja Criuleni is a beach in Administrative-Territorial Units of the Left Bank of the Dniester, Moldova. Plaja Criuleni is situated nearby to the sports venue Stadionul Raional Criuleni, as well as near the pitch Teren de fotbal.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Dzerjinscoe is a village in the Dubăsari District of Transnistria, Moldova. It has since 1990 been administered as a part of the breakaway Pridnestrovian Moldavian Republic.
